What is FCC Self-Assessment
The Family-Centered Care Self-Assessment Tool is a healthcare assessment form used by outpatient health care providers to evaluate their implementation of family-centered care practices.

Key Features of the Family-Centered Care Self-Assessment Tool
The Family-Centered Care Self-Assessment Tool features multiple sections that specifically focus on different aspects of care, including family/provider partnerships and care setting practices. These sections facilitate tracking progress over time, ensuring continuous evaluation and improvement.
